"Default Deadline Looms as Fate Rests on Four Individuals"

TL;DR Summary
A new quartet consisting of White House counselor Steve Ricchetti, budget chief Shalanda Young, legislative affairs chief Louisa Terrell, and McCarthy emissary Rep. Garret Graves (R-La.) is leading negotiations for President Joe Biden and the Big Four congressional leaders to avert a debt disaster. Both sides remain far apart, but lawmakers from both parties acknowledged that if anyone can cut a deal in time, it’s the group of advisers now at the table. The negotiators have been tight-lipped as they work toward a deal that can somehow clear both chambers in the next few weeks.
